Black, red and white chinagraphs or soft lead cartridge pencil.

Don't you hate winter when condensation forms on cold tiles and your chinagraphs don't work?! :mad2:

If nothing will stick to the tile, put a small piece of blue painters tape where you want to make your mark. The tape gives you the surface needed to make your pencil mark and cleans up easy.

I still use staedler pencils for setting out and general matt finish tiles but now use the Pica marker pencil for gloss etc tiles.
